Review of The Citizen (2012) by Frank Scheck for The Hollywood Reporter — 26 Sep 2013
The film’s chief asset is Nabaway, who delivers a subtly moving and restrained performance that transcends the contrived plot mechanics. It’s a heartfelt turn that befits this well-intentioned but ultimately reductive film.
